WEST, Judge.

This is an appeal from a judgment and sentence of guilty on charges of D.U.I., Operating a Vehicle while License was Suspended for a violation of KRS 189A.010, Speeding, Improper Registration, and Improper Registration Plates. Appellant raises three (3) arguments on appeal, two (2) of which are aimed at the conviction for operating a motor vehicle while his license was suspended for driving under the influence of drugs or alcohol.
